En effet, lors des questions réponses sur les derniers manga full color, une personne demande la raison de la taille de la planète de Kaïoh.
En voici la réponse :
Q7: Why is Kaiō’s planet so small?
The fact is it was destroyed by the god of destruction.
It used to be so big that its diameter was about 100 times that of Kaiō’s current planet. Apart from the size it was completely the same as it is now, with nothing but grassy fields and roads. Kaiō-sama enjoyed his hobby, driving, but then one day Birus, the God of Destruction, stopped by and they played a video game together (it was a car racing one). Birus lost, and so the planet was destroyed by the peeved God of Destruction. Kaiō then took a large leftover fragment, whittled it down to a sphere, and built a road on it so that he could have fun driving there. This became Kaiō’s current planet.
On peut voir ici une chose vraiment intéressante, dans un Q/A qui concerne le manga et uniquement le manga et qui est donc canon, Toriyama inclus Birus dans la timeline.
